STAT 360
Introduction to Bayesian Statistics
Loyola University Chicago ·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
An introduction to Bayesian data analysis and statistical inference. Topics include single and multiple Bayesian models, hierarchical models, Bayesian linear regression models. The course will also consider computational methods related to Bayesian inference such as Markov Chain Monte Carlo methods. Emphasis is placed on both theoretical understanding and practical implementation using statistical software.
